diff options
author | Jeremy Huddleston Sequoia <[email protected]> | 2015-02-10 22:21:47 -0800 |
---|---|---|
committer | Jeremy Huddleston Sequoia <[email protected]> | 2015-02-10 22:22:33 -0800 |
commit | e68b67b53fce39a8c93188262d9e795ca50750ac (patch) | |
tree | 4d35e97fb38787e380dcf7d20cc51456777ce268 | |
parent | 1c67a5687a35e984323b6034adb914a66d64bb2f (diff) |
darwin: build fix
xfont.c:237:14: error: implicit declaration of function 'GetGLXDRIDrawable' is invalid in C99 [-Werror,-Wimplicit-function-declaration]
glxdraw = GetGLXDRIDrawable(CC->currentDpy, CC->currentDrawable);
^
Fixes regression from 291be28476ea60c6fb1eb2a882e2e25def5d3735
Signed-off-by: Jeremy Huddleston Sequoia <[email protected]>
-rw-r--r-- | src/glx/xfont.c |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/src/glx/xfont.c b/src/glx/xfont.c index a086b7a03ef..00498bc3ea4 100644 --- a/src/glx/xfont.c +++ b/src/glx/xfont.c @@ -221,7 +221,10 @@ DRI_glXUseXFont(struct glx_context *CC, Font font, int first, int count, int lis XGCValues values; unsigned long valuemask; XFontStruct *fs; + +#if !defined(GLX_USE_APPLEGL) __GLXDRIdrawable *glxdraw; +#endif GLint swapbytes, lsbfirst, rowlength; GLint skiprows, skippixels, alignment; @@ -234,9 +237,11 @@ DRI_glXUseXFont(struct glx_context *CC, Font font, int first, int count, int lis dpy = CC->currentDpy; win = CC->currentDrawable; +#if !defined(GLX_USE_APPLEGL) glxdraw = GetGLXDRIDrawable(CC->currentDpy, CC->currentDrawable); if (glxdraw) win = glxdraw->xDrawable; +#endif fs = XQueryFont(dpy, font); if (!fs) { |